Hamas signals on hostage release and a pause in fighting
Hamas has drafted a letter directed to President Trump via Qatar proposing a 60-day ceasefire in exchange for the immediate release of half of the hostages. The message has not yet been delivered to the president. In parallel, a Hamas-identified propaganda clip appeared claiming to show a hostage alive, underscoring the group’s ongoing effort to shape narratives around the captivity and the conflict’s dynamics as Israeli operations continue at multiple fronts.

On the battlefield inside Gaza, a confrontation in the city’s Sheikh Radwan neighborhood around 10:00 AM ended with a serious injury to a senior Israeli officer and the neutralization of three militants. The force, drawn from the Shaked Battalion of the Givati Brigade, conducted ground searches after the close-quarters engagement, and the militants’ weapons, including RPGs, were seized. No additional Israeli casualties were reported in this incident.

Diplomatic and strategic developments beyond Gaza
The Kremlin signaled a forthcoming “special statement” from President Vladimir Putin later tonight, a development that is being watched for potential geopolitical repercussions in Europe and the broader Middle East, including implications for Russia’s ties with Iran and its posture toward Western policy in the region.

In a broader international economic and political shift, Singapore announced targeted sanctions on leaders of Israeli settler groups and signaled that it could recognize a Palestinian state under carefully defined conditions. The move aligns with a growing cohort of states weighing or pursuing recognition of Palestinian statehood as part of a broader strategy to pressure toward a resolution of the Israeli-Palestinian conflict.

Bedouin communities facing eviction amid settlement expansion
In the West Bank near Jerusalem, Bedouin families of the Jahalin group are confronting the loss of grazing lands as Israeli settlement activity expands into surrounding valleys and scrubland. The 80-strong community has faced shrinking land for generations, and eviction would mark a significant displacement amid the broader territorial tensions surrounding the city and adjacent areas.

International technology and security cooperation
In a notable cross-border collaboration, Nvidia and the UAE’s Technology Innovation Institute announced the launch of the Middle East’s first joint AI and robotics laboratory in Abu Dhabi. The facility is described as a hub for developing next-generation AI models, robotics platforms, and humanoid technologies intended to accelerate innovation across multiple industries in the region and beyond.
